What is vp.net?

vp.net is a VPN service dedicated to enhancing user privacy via a zero-knowledge model and advanced, hardware-enforced security protocols, ensuring that connections are verifiable and end-to-end encrypted, such that even the provider cannot monitor user activities. By employing Intel SGX enclaves together with attestation services, vp.net confirms the authenticity of its code execution and allows for audits, offering users indisputable proof that no logs are stored and their data remains separate from secure sessions. The service's performance is bolstered by state-of-the-art packet-routing technology, achieving notably faster speeds compared to competitors, while allowing users to retain full control over their devices, which keeps their network traffic anonymous and makes any metadata collection virtually impossible. Focused on empowering its users, vp.net guarantees that only they can access their session details, promoting a transparent and verifiable operation that transcends simple assurances, thus solidifying trust in the service. What is AWS Nitro Enclaves?

AWS Nitro Enclaves empowers users to create secure and isolated computing spaces that bolster the security of highly sensitive information, such as personally identifiable information (PII), healthcare records, financial data, and intellectual property, all within their Amazon EC2 instances. By employing the same Nitro Hypervisor technology that provides CPU and memory separation for EC2 instances, Nitro Enclaves significantly reduces the potential attack vectors for applications that process sensitive data. These enclaves offer a protected, confined, and isolated environment for running applications that are critical to security. Moreover, Nitro Enclaves includes cryptographic attestation to confirm that only authorized software is in operation and works in conjunction with the AWS Key Management Service to ensure that access to sensitive information is strictly limited to your enclaves. This combination of advanced security protocols allows organizations to effectively manage their most crucial data while adhering to rigorous regulatory standards.
